摘要

PPROBLEM TO BE SOLVED: To produce an organic fertilizer without exhibiting bad smell pollution, having a marked fertilizing effect and improving power for soil having rich nutrition by utilizing organic waste materials and general garbage as valuable resources, not only treating them but also fermentation type decomposition-treating them for realizing a circulation type environmental society without pollution. PSOLUTION: This method for producing the fertilizer is provided by heating water, mineral water, mineral ion water or mineral spring water, pouring plant components containing starches and sugars such as the outer skin, germ or albumen of cereals, the outer skin, germ, albumen of beans for heat-treating. Most sundry bacteria weak to heat are killed and thermophiles such as lactobacillus, etc., enduring high temperature survive and organic acids such as lactic acid are obtained in a later process. After cooling by leaving as it is, by adding malted rice for saccharification, saccharide such as glucose, etc., and 50 kinds enzymes produced by green mold are obtained. As the saccharification progresses, many kinds of organic acids are produced. Further cooling by leaving as it is, by adding yeast to propagate, the fermentation type decomposition-accelerating enzyme agent is produced by obtaining nutritious materials such as amino acids, vitamins, etc., and alcohols produced by the yeast. 需要解决的问题:通过利用有机废料和一般垃圾作为有价值的资源,不产生臭味污染,具有显着的施肥效果并改善营养丰富的土壤的能力,生产有机肥料,不仅要对其进行处理,而且还要对其进行处理。发酵型分解处理,实现无污染的循环型环境社会。

解决方案:这种肥料的生产方法是通过加热水,矿泉水,矿物质离子水或矿泉水,倒入含有淀粉和糖类的植物成分(例如外皮,谷物的胚芽或蛋白),外皮来提供的,胚芽,豆蛋白进行热处理。大多数不耐热的杂菌被杀死,嗜热菌如乳杆菌等得以生存,经久耐高温得以生存,并在随后的过程中获得了有机酸如乳酸。静置冷却后,加入麦芽大米进行糖化,得到葡萄糖等糖类,通过绿霉得到50种酶。随着糖化的进行,产生了多种有机酸。通过添加酵母进行繁殖而使其原样进一步冷却,通过获得营养物质,例如氨基酸,维生素等以及酵母产生的醇,来生产发酵型分解促进酶剂。
